Introduction
At Cedar adverts, we're a premier electronic advertising and marketing agency based in San Francisco, California, offering major-tier advertising alternatives that empower companies to establish a robust on https://carlyrchx300168.blogvivi.com/34330490/cedar-advertisements-top-digital-advertising-and-marketing-company-in-california